( anthocyanidins ). [ ] flavanols possess two chiral carbons, meaning four diastereoisomers occur for each of them. catechins are distinguished from the yellow, ketone-containing flavonoids such as quercitin and rutin , which are called flavonols . early use of the term bioflavonoid was imprecisely
the catechins are abundant in teas derived from the tea plant camellia sinensis , as well as in some cocoas and chocolates [ ] (made from the seeds of theobroma cacao ). catechins are also present in the human diet in fruits, vegetables and wine , [ ] and are found in many other plant species.
